6.2.13. - Page 16 <br />SECTION 11® PARKING ACCESS AND REVENUE CONTROL SYSTEM <br />PART I - GENERAL <br />1.1 RELATED DOCUMENTS <br />A. Related Sections <br />Parking System Description <br />1.2 GARAGE PARKING ACCESS AND REVENUE CONTROL (PARC) SYSTEM: <br />A. System Description <br />PARCS at two (2) off-street parking facilities ("garages") that will be integrated and remotely <br />monitored by a Central Monitoring Station (CMS) for customer support and revenue security <br />oversight. The System must be remotely accessible over an encrypted internet-based (TCP/IP) <br />network. <br />The overall System shall: <br />1. Support the operators' management of the facility. <br />2. Provide remote monitoring (CCTV) and intercom assistance to users on the PARCS. <br />3. Provide revenue security. <br />4. Provide quick and easy customer interaction with PARCS. <br />5. Provide a high resolution video to the FMS and CMS of all PARCS with which a customer <br />interacts. <br />6. Provide the ability for FMS and CMS to remotely issue replacement tickets to the pay <br />stations and ticket acceptors (e.g. lost or damaged tickets, etc.). <br />7. Allow remote programming of all pay stations and lane equipment. <br />8. Allow for remote vending of gates. <br />9. Be able to read Bar codes and QR codes as a means for validation.. <br />10. Use credit and debit cards for in -lane payments and card-in/card-out features. <br />11. Include proximity access card readers for access by monthly parkers. <br />B. The System must also: <br />1. Provide comprehensive and reliable system reporting for sound revenue security controls. <br />2. Provide accurate and auditable fee computation through automation. <br />3. Incorporate multiple levels of security and PARCS access control both onsite and remotely. <br />4. Provide a comprehensive and cohesive methodology for auditing the system, showing <br />every transaction performed in the facility and identifying each and summarizing all <br />exception -based transactions performed. <br />S. Provide secure, Web -based access to the CMS for all functions. The City shall be able to <br />gain access to PARCS data via a web enabled browser, within the local network. <br />6. Provide near real time transaction times for each of the PARCS equipment. <br />7. Provide configurable and consolidated operational and management reports capable of <br />being exported to Excel and exported to PDF format and emailed to any email address. <br />Email server and/or account for email will be provided by the City. <br />REV: 09-10-15 VR <br />Page 13 of 61 <br />ATTY/AGR.2015.217/Scheidt & Bachmann USA, Inc.
